Myth 1: Cash Buyers Offer Lower Prices

One common fallacy is that cash purchasers give much lower prices than typical buyers. While it is true that cash purchasers frequently seek savings for the convenience and quickness of a cash transaction, this only sometimes implies accepting rock-bottom prices. In many circumstances, cash purchasers will pay fair market value for properties, especially if they are in high demand or have distinctive attributes.

Myth 2: Cash Sales are Only for Distressed Properties

Contrary to popular assumption, cash sales do not only apply to distressed houses. While it is true that cash purchasers frequently choose distressed homes due to their potential for repair and profit, cash transactions can occur on any property. Cash sales include a wide variety of properties, from move-in ready homes to fixer-uppers, and offer sellers a simple alternative to traditional financing.

Myth 4: Cash Sales are Always Fast

Cash sales are famed for their quickness and efficiency, although they are only sometimes instantaneous. The timing of a cash transaction might vary depending on a number of factors, including market conditions, property quality, and buyer preferences. While some cash sales can be completed within a few days, others may take many weeks. To ensure a seamless transaction, sellers must first discuss their objectives and timetables with possible cash purchasers.

Myth 5: Cash Buyers Will Not Negotiate.

Some homeowners assume that cash buyers are rigid and unwilling to compromise on price or terms. However, like with any real estate purchase, negotiating is an expected part of the process. Cash buyers may bargain based on property conditions, market trends, and the seller's desire to complete the transaction. Sellers should be prepared to engage in negotiations and analyze multiple offers before making a decision.

Myth 7: Cash Buyers Require Properties to be in Perfect Condition

While some cash buyers prefer properties in good shape, others are ready to acquire homes in varied levels of disrepair. Cash buyers frequently specialize in remodeling projects and are used to working with houses that require repairs or renovations. Sellers should not be discouraged from considering cash transactions because they are concerned about the condition of their property. There are cash buyers ready to take on even the most difficult renovation jobs.

Myth 10: Cash Sales Provide no Benefits to Sellers

Contrary to popular assumption, cash sales provide sellers with benefits beyond speed and convenience. Cash transactions simplify the selling process by eliminating the need for financing contingencies and assessments, lowering the chance of deals falling through. Furthermore, cash sales frequently involve lower fees and closing costs, leaving more money in the seller's pocket. A cash sale can be an appealing alternative for homeowners who want to sell quickly and easily.
